Expert Opinion

Like a blinking warning light on a dashboard, the call from 800‑824‑9289 can catch you off guard. It often claims to be an American Express fraud alert, urging you to verify recent charges. Before you share any personal or account details, hang up and call the number on the back of your card or log into your online account. Treat unsolicited pre‑recorded messages as potential phishing attempts, especially if they ask for your SSN or full card number. Keep a record of the call’s date and content, and report suspicious activity to your card issuer’s official fraud department. A cautious approach protects your credit and peace of mind.
